Output 0162a69e306c9083c79793723185acdbd23831af9da44f55deda113bf20569ea:3

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 b45319df39b7e819455f84a4c851a4934763843e
address
tb1qk3f3nheekl5pj32lsjjvs5dyjdrk8pp7tqnz60
transaction
0162a69e306c9083c79793723185acdbd23831af9da44f55deda113bf20569ea